Embrace the Medina’s Maze
Most Moroccan cities revolve around their medina. The lanes are narrow filled with sound of people working and aroma of spices permeating the air. Never hesitate to negotiate price because it is expected in this region. Remember, across the Medina’s labyrinth you will discover incredible things like handcrafted leather goods or artistically hand-woven carpets.
Savor the Flavors
Moroccan food is a union of Mediterranean, Arabic, and Berber civilizations.
You MUST try:
- Tagine, a slow-cooked stew full of flavorful spices, veggies, and soft meats.
- Fluffy couscous served with seven different types of vegetables.
- The cool mint tea, which symbolizes Moroccan generosity.
- The street cuisine, which is cheap yet delicious. You get an idea of how the locals live.

Dress Appropriately
Dress modestly while traveling to Morocco even if majority of tourist sites disperse a laid-back vibe. When you visit religious sites or rural areas, women must wear clothes that cover their shoulders and knees. So, choose lightweight and breathable fabric for your travel. Also add a scarf in your suitcase because it can protect you from the scorching heat and you will also cover your head as you enter the mosque.
Navigate with Ease
Driving through the medinas may be a daunting experience initially but that is part of the adventure. There is no need to fear asking directions but you should be aware about unofficial guides. Reach an agreement on a fee in advance, when you choose to take their help. Within a greater distance, a public transportation such as grand taxis (shared taxis) or a bus is fine.

Respect Local Customs
Appreciating and learning the local traditions will significantly improve your trip. Moroccans are friendly and hospitable. You should never leave your shoes on when visiting a home or a mosque. Although photography is not restricted, it is always good to seek permission to take pictures of individuals, more so ladies.
